Step 1
Heat a large skillet over medium high heat. Add the olive oil, onion, and pepper, sprinkle with ¼ teaspoon salt, and cook until just softened, about 3 minutes, stirring frequently.
Step 2
Add the ground beef, sprinkle with ¼ teaspoon salt, and cook until browned and just cooked through, about 5 minutes. Add the beef stock and stir to get any browned bits from the bottom of the pan.
Step 3
Carefully transfer the cooked beef and onion mixture to a 6-quart slow cooker. Add the beans, tomato sauce, diced tomatoes, garlic powder, cumin, paprika, chili powder, sugar, and 1 teaspoon salt, stirring to combine.
Step 4
Cover and cook on high for 3-5 hours, or low for 5-7, or until the beef is very tender.
Step 5
Taste and adjust seasons as desired and serve with optional toppings.
